Here's your Days of our Lives recap for what happened in Salem on Friday, July 4, 2025.
What happened on Days of our Lives

At Stephanie’s apartment, she told Alex that she might do PR work for EJ. “Didn’t you tell me this guy had you kidnapped?” Alex asked. Stephanie explained that although she loathed EJ if she helped him, it would help the hospital and her mother. Alex told Stephanie that it was not worth it. Stephanie said she was not afraid and that she planned to meet with EJ before she made a decision. Alex suggested that Stephanie quit working in PR and become a writer full time. Stephanie said that she was not ready to give up her PR work because she enjoyed it.
“Full transparency. Titan is struggling. And I think your book is exactly what we need to turn everything around for all of us,” Alex said. “In other words, you want this for you,” Stephanie said. Alex stressed that he wanted that future for them both.
At the pub, Roman asked Kate about Philip. “Philip is thrilled to be out of the hospital. So how about you? How are you doing?” Kate asked. Roman insisted he was fine, but Kate pointed out that Roman had been tossing and turning in bed all night. “Are you still blaming yourself for Johnny's predicament?” Kate asked. Roman said he did. Kate reminded Roman that Johnny had claimed he was innocent of the shooting.
“I know he is. However, I sure as hell didn’t do him any favors by wiping the prints off that gun and concealing it,” Roman said. “You were trying to protect your grandson,” Kate stressed. Roman said it did not matter, because he had made everything worse. Kate told Roman that he had made the right choice in having talked to the police. “We both know [EJ will] fight like hell for his son,” Kate said. Roman lamented that he had been forced to drag Rachel into the situation.
“Too many people knew the truth,” Kate said. Roman thanked Kate for her support. Roman told Kate that he hoped she could pick up the slack at the pub for him during Johnny’s trial. “You can count on me,” Kate said. When Alex and Stephanie walked in, Alex said, “I thought you would have ditched the apron by now. You’re starting at Titan next week.” Kate declined the job because of Roman. Alex appealed to Kate.
“Alex is right. Your notes that you gave me were so smart and insightful,” Stephanie said. Kate raised her eyebrows. Embarrassed, Stephanie admitted that she was the author. Stephanie stressed that she had only agreed to let Alex publish the book because he had promised that Kate would help her edit it. Alex and Stephanie argued that it was clear that Kate loved the creative process, and that she should take the job for her benefit. Roman walked over. “Alex offered me a job at Titan, and I’ve decided to take it,” Kate said.
While Rachel was at the Fourth of July parade with a friend, Brady and Kristen talked in the penthouse about how to arrange for Rachel to talk to the police. Marlena overheard them, and Brady asked her for advice. “Advise her that all she needs to do is tell the truth,” Marlena said. “Yes, but I think we all know that Johnny did it,” Kristen said. Marlena stressed that she believed Johnny’s claim that he was innocent.
“Then why did his grandfather cover for him? Why didn’t Johnny come forward sooner?” Kristen asked. “He probably thought that no one would believe him,” Brady said. Kristen argued that Johnny’s story did not make sense. Brady countered that Johnny’s words of anger after the revelations about his conception did not mean he was a murderer. Kristen scoffed at the idea. Kristen reminded Brady that Will had shot EJ.
“Johnny and his brother have a lot in common,” Kristen said. “Stop it!” Marlena yelled. Upset, Marlena told Brady to text her when Kristen was gone, and she left the penthouse. “What the hell?” Brady growled at Kristen. Kristen said she refused to ignore the evidence. “[Rachel’s] testimony is going to send her cousin to prison for a very, very long time. And we are going to have to help her deal with that,” Kristen said. Brady warned Kristen not to get ahead of the situation.
“Rachel needs to know that we are both here for her,” Brady said. Brady asked her if Rachel could stay at the penthouse until after the trial. “To keep her away from EJ,” Brady said. Kristen agreed. Kristen asked for unrestricted visitation. Brady agreed, but he told Kristen to avoid Marlena because she was still struggling after John’s death.
At the police station, Belle was working in the interrogation room when Paulina walked in. Paulina informed Belle that the judge had reinstated Belle to the case. Belle was confused. Paulina added that EJ had managed to get the case moved up. When Paulina hinted that EJ had influenced the judge, Belle stressed that no matter what EJ had done, she would handle the case with integrity.
Abe knocked on the door to Chanel’s apartment. After a much-needed hug, Chanel told Abe that she was not ready to forgive her mother for having pushed for Johnny’s arrest. Abe reminded Chanel that Paulina was caught in a difficult situation as the mayor.
“Have faith that the jury will do right by [Johnny], and he’ll be acquitted,” Abe said. “I want to believe that, Abe. But I don’t know if I do,” Chanel confessed. Chanel shared with Abe her concerns that EJ would use the situation to reinsert himself into Johnny’s life. “That is the last thing that Johnny needs right now. The last thing I need,” Chanel said. Paulina dropped by, but Chanel was still mad at her. When Chanel asked if Paulina believed in Johnny’s innocence, she said she did not know. To calm the situation, Abe took Paulina by the hand and walked her out.
As Abe walked through the square with Paulina, he noted that Chanel needed to blame someone for Johnny’s situation. “Unfortunately, that someone is you,” Abe said. “I guess I’ll just have to ride it out,” Paulina said. Paulina told Abe that she was grateful that he was there for her and Chanel.
Belle went to the square to get a coffee, and she ran into Marlena. As Marlena started to repeat Kristen’s comments, Belle shut her down. Belle informed Marlena that she had been reinstated on the case. “Now I have to prosecute my nephew while I go toe to toe with my boyfriend,” Belle muttered. “Your boyfriend?” Marlena said. Belle reminded Marlena that she had advised her to follow her heart. When Belle returned to the police station, she found an envelope with a memory card inside it.
In the DiMera living room, Johnny met up with EJ to review the case. EJ informed Johnny about what Rachel had witnessed the night of the shooting. “No wonder she’s been acting so strangely toward me lately. That poor kid. She’s been keeping this a secret the whole time,” Johnny said. EJ admitted that he had convinced Kristen to keep Rachel quiet but that when Roman had turned in his gun, the police had learned about Rachel.
“I have been wracking my brain trying to remember things from that night, but my mind is blank. Are you sure you don’t recall seeing anyone on your way out?” EJ asked. Johnny said no. EJ recounted the list of people that had been at the house, and he focused on Kristen. “My memory is coming back to me in bits and pieces. Who knows what I’ll eventually remember about that night,” EJ said. Johnny urged EJ not to falsely accuse Kristen.
“If it’s not Kristen, then who could it be?” EJ said. “Maybe it’s somebody we haven’t considered yet,” Johnny suggested. EJ noted that he had given plenty of people a reason to want him dead. Johnny said he still could not believe that EJ had thought he was the shooter and that EJ had protected him. EJ told Johnny that he would always support him.
“I just wish your wife understood that I only want what’s best for you,” EJ said. EJ argued that Chanel wanted to turn Johnny against him. “She’s just trying to protect me. Same as you,” Johnny said. Johnny noted that Chanel would come around in time. “We can win this case on merit,” Johnny said. EJ noted that the evidence against Johnny was enough to secure a conviction, but he promised to do anything crazy.
After Johnny left, Kristen returned home. “I am so sorry the police found out what Rachel said,” Kristen said. Kristen explained that Rachel had talked in her sleep in front of Marlena. EJ asked Kristen if she planned to hold up her end of their deal. When Kristen argued that she could not keep Rachel from testifying, EJ suggested that she coach Rachel’s testimony. Kristen warned EJ not to hurt her mother or daughter, or EJ would regret it. “If my son goes to prison, Kristen, that might just have devastating consequences for you and the people you love,” EJ growled.
When Johnny returned home, Chanel told Johnny about Paulina’s visit. “The last thing that I want to do is come between you and your mom,” Johnny said. Chanel asked about Johnny’s meeting. Johnny said the case was going well. When Chanel pressed Johnny about his personal relationship with EJ, Johnny admitted that things were improving. Chanel said she was not happy about it, but she understood. “But please just promise me that you will keep your guard up around him,” Chanel said. “I promise,” Johnny said.
At the penthouse, Marlena apologized to Brady for having walked out on Kristen. “I’m sorry she upset you,” Brady said. Brady asked Marlena to join him and the kids for fireworks. “That sounds really nice. I think we could all use some cheering up right now,” Marlena said.
